Exercise and use of enhancement drugs at the time of the COVID-19 pandemic: A multicultural study on poping strategies during self-Isolation and related risks
Little is known about the impact of restrictive measures during the COVID-19 pandemic on self-image and engagement in exercise and other coping strategies alongside the use of image and performance-enhancing drugs (IPEDs) to boost performance and appearance.
